عنوان انگلیسی مقاله ISI
A new developed radiochromic film for high-dose dosimetry applications

چکیده انگلیسی


• Preparation of PVB film dosimeter incorporating a radiochromic leuco brilliant blue dye for use in routine processing dosimetry.
• The dosimeter useful dose range is 1–165 kGy.
• The response is not markedly dependent on humidity during irradiation in the range of 0–60%.
• The response of unirradiated and irradiated film is good stable during storage period of 63 days.
• Overall uncertainty of the dosimeter 8.96% at 2σ.

A colorless polyvinyl butyral film (PVB) based on a radiochromic leuco brilliant blue cyanide dye (LBB), was investigated as a high-dose dosimeter for gamma radiation processing applications in the dose range of 3–165 kGy. The useful applications for such dose range are food irradiation treatment, medical devices sterilization, and polymer modification. Upon γ-ray exposure, the prepared film undergoes visual color change to deep blue color characterized with an absorption band peaking at 638 nm. The variation in response of irradiated film stored in the dark and under laboratory light illumination was less than 5% during the first week of storage. The effect of temperature and relative humidity on the performance of film during irradiation and the overall uncertainty associated with absorbed dose monitoring were investigated in the present study.
